Job description

Are you energized by building partnerships that shape how technology reaches customers at scale? As a Sr. Technical Business Developer at Amazon, you will identify, evaluate, negotiate, and manage strategic partnerships and complex deals that drive meaningful business outcomes across organizations. This role puts you at the intersection of business strategy and technology, where you will define and execute business development strategies that complement product roadmaps. You will work directly with cross-functional teams to uncover new opportunities, influence product direction through customer and partner feedback, and deliver measurable impact. If you are a self-starter who thrives on turning ambiguity into action and building relationships that move the needle, we want to hear from you.

Export Control Requirement: Due to applicable export control laws and regulations, candidates must be a U.S. citizen or national, U.S. permanent resident (i.e., current Green Card holder), or lawfully admitted into the U.S. as a refugee or granted asylum.

Key job responsibilities
  • Negotiate and secure customized design and engineering services agreements with defined technical and business commits. Variety of contracts may include: terms sheets, NDAs, MOU/LOIs, SOWs, Design/Services. etc..
  • Influence internal/external C-Suite executives and applying sound business judgement combined with technical acumen.
  • Analyze 5G/3GPP trends and emerging technologies to identify differentiating solution acquisition, capability investment and cost/risk reduction opportunities that benefit Amazon and its' customers
  • Define and structure multi-party business models that solve IP ownership, capability and operational barriers.
  • Develop negotiation strategies; lead cross-functional negotiation teams; anticipate and mitigate contractual/operational risks.
  • Evaluate opportunities to improve cost, reduce risk and win other favorable commercial/legal terms with vendors`.
  • Develop processes and tracking mechanisms to manage project execution and progress reporting that ensure obligations are met in a timely and competent manner.
  • Communicate proposals and recommendation/justification to gain executive approval of technology business deals.
  • Prepare and deliver business reviews to senior leadership updating on progress and roadblocks.
About the team

Amazon Leo is Amazon's low Earth orbit satellite network. Our mission is to deliver fast, reliable connectivity to customers beyond the reach of existing networks. From individual households to schools, hospitals, businesses, and government agencies, Amazon Leo will serve people and organizations operating in locations without reliable connectivity. One of the most ambitious missions that Amazon has undertaken to date, the Leo satellite constellation, is our solution to providing reliable communications to the entire world.

The success of Amazon Leo depends on the quality, reliability, cost, manufacturability, throughput, and security of the products that you deliver. Basic Qualifications:
  • 5+ years of developing, negotiating and executing business agreements experience
  • 5+ years of solving problems with technology in the Telecommunications industry experience
  • Bachelor degree in engineering or business/related technical/quantitative field with relevant applied technical work history.
  • 5+ years of experience with progressive responsibility in strategic technology sourcing and/or business development in consumer electronics, client/enterprise compute, networking communication, IoT, Mobile Communications, Automotive, and aerospace avionics fields.
  • 3+ years of technology business development or semiconductor design-consulting, contract manufacturing, and testing services in either procurement or sales - including demonstrated record negotiating contracts for hardware and services deals w/ tier1 major technology companies.
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Experience identifying, negotiating, and executing complex legal agreements
  • Experience with wireless communication systems, preferably 5G and/or 3GPP related.
  • Experience in communicating with users, other technical teams, and senior leadership to collect requirements, describe software product features, technical designs, and product strategy
  • Ability to write persuasive business proposals and presenting to technical and non-technical VP/C-Suite level executives.
  • Deep analytical and quantitative skills - with ability to draw insightful and actionable conclusions from diverse information.
